Occupation: Camera Operator The backrooms (Kane Pixels version) The Backrooms (also known as the Complex (more commonly) or Hallways by members of Async) is a parallel dimension consisting of distorted imitations of places from our reality, primarily appearing as enormous interconnected spaces of similar rooms, hallways, and doorways. While it also contains several unique looking areas, the largest area borrows the appearance of an empty or unfurnished office building with bright yellow wallpaper, tiled ceilings, and buzzing fluorescent light fixtures. The Backrooms is dotted with multiple different "Null Zones", which are small areas in which the Backrooms and the “real world” are able to connect. It is possible to fall out of reality and into the Backrooms through these Null Zones within the “real world.” The Backrooms is shown to not abide by the rules of the real world in some cases. Time travel into the future or the past is sometimes shown to be possible, at least inside or near these Null Zones. The topography of the Backrooms varies from area to area, but all areas in the Backrooms have a heavy resemblance to areas in the real world. There are many objects created by the Backrooms; these objects vary and sometimes fit in with the area where they are found. Noises with no source can be heard throughout the Backrooms, sometimes distorted and unable to be comprehended. The walls in the Backrooms are distorted in various sections, bending and twisting in unnatural ways. All areas of the Backrooms are in some way seamlessly connected, either by regular doorways and hallways or unorthodox ways such as holes in the floor and walls. There are "Null Zones" within the Backrooms, which Async theorizes are doorways between the real world and the Backrooms. Null Zones are located everywhere in the Backrooms; it is through Null Zones that things and people fall through when entering the Backrooms. The Threshold created by Async is connected to one. Still lives The Still Life are a group of neutral, uncanny entities created by the Backrooms that attempt to replicate humans, resulting in distorted imitations. Redhead still life The Redheaded Still Life is implied to either be a Still Life version of Clark’s ex-wife or have a similar appearance. She has red hair like his ex-wife, but her face appears to be a fusion of 3 separate faces at different angles. She wears a red pinstripe suit, tights, and high heels. Archibald Leland Sutter still life Archibald Leland Sutter is a Still Life copy of an unknown person. His face is warped, one eye being moved to his forehead, his nose being flatted, and his face being elongated. He has three legs which seem to be non-functional. He "sits" in a wheelchair connected to a lamp which he is able to turn on or off at his will, in reality he is physically merged into the chair. He wears a black suit with a white undershirt and a black tie. Bearded Still life He has six eyes. He is wearing a white shirt with blue, pink, beige and red stripes alongside another set of buttons and a second collar attached to the right side of his shirt. He has a beard and a deformed nose which appears to be three noses "clipped" into each other with two of his eyes where they should be, 2 eyes above it but smaller, along with two eyes below it that are slightly smaller he is a copy of a unknown person who entered the backrooms. His interior is made up entirely of white gelationous material, a feature of other Still Life creatures. Captain Clark Still life "Captain Clark" is a Still Life of the Backrooms and primary antagonist of the Backrooms Movie. He is the doppelganger of Clark, the protagonist of the Backrooms Movie. "Captain Clark" appears very similar to Clark, but vastly taller, with a face that is slightly stretched upward. His hands are malformed, with the fingers on each hand being at varying lengths, and his left leg is seemingly replaced with the leg of a table, similar to Clark's peg leg when dressed as a pirate. He is also much taller than other Still Life's, seemingly at least twice the size of Clark. He is also wearing similar clothes to Clark. Humans Clark Clark is a furniture store owner and the protagonist of the 2026 Backrooms film. He is the owner of the failing furniture store Cap'n Clark's Ottoman Empire, he would find a Null Zone in the basement of his store. Clark is a middle aged African American Man. He has short black hair and a thick black beard. He usually dons a tucked in collared dress shirt with two large pockets on opposite sides and rolled up sleeves along with a brown leather belt and black dress pants. On his wrist is a gold colored watch with a brown leather band. He has thick eyebrows and wrinkles on his forehead. Clark was a bitter, insecure, isolated, and very unhappy middle-aged man, largely due to his alcoholism, divorce with his wife, failure as an architect, and the near-bankrupt state of his store. After finding a Null Zone in the basement of his furniture store, he became dangerously obsessed with the Backrooms. However, the isolation of the Backrooms led Clark to become deeply unhinged and ignoring of his real-world life and responsibilities. The amplification of his negative traits, especially his insecurity and negative perception of himself, eventually manifested into Captain Clark, a physical being that closely resembles Clark's commercialized "Cap'n Clark" persona and mascot, albeit grotesque, disfigured, and of great stature. Clark is characterized as the struggling owner of Cap'n Clark's Ottoman Empire. During an entire-store sale there, he discovers a maze of endless spaces on the other side of his basement wall, which he immediately obsesses over, given the fact he’s a failed architect. This decision could possibly be a window into his mind at the time, during which his entire store was on sale with the tagline "Everything must go!", likely implying that Cap'n Clark's would soon close permanently, which may also explain why he seeks therapy. Although, it is later implied that he only goes to therapy to validate himself instead of actually trying to change for the better. This is because he believes he is incapable of change, saying it’s “just the way [he’s] wired”. Mary Kline Mary Kline was born to Nora Kline and an unknown father, and grew up with her mother suffering from severe Schizophrenia. It can be assumed that her father left before Mary's birth. Her home was boarded up and its windows covered, and she was forbidden to ever go outside. Nora is soon sent to a psychiatric hospital. As an adult, Mary received a doctorate in psychology and became a liscensed therapist. She would soon begin treating a man named Clark, a troubled store owner suffering from alcoholism. Mary helps him through his past divorce with his ex-wife, Barbara, as Clark fails to recognize his faults in the relationship. On July 3rd, 1990, Clark reveals that he discovered the Backrooms, though she did not believe him. A week and a half later, she receives a voicemail from Clark, goes to Cap'n Clark's Ottoman Empire, and discovers a Null Zone in the downstairs of the store. She enters the Backrooms and later encounters Clark, visibly unstable. Mary Kline is a slender Caucasian woman with shoulder-length dark brown hair and brown eyes. She dresses in business casual attire typical of the early 90s—blazers with large shoulder-pads, tailored trousers, and long skirts. She appears to have liking for blouses with bold patterns such as paisley. When she investigates Clark’s disappearance, she wears a short-sleeved collared shirt with a pastel watercolor pattern, high-waisted dark gray pants, and a brown leather belt with matching slip-on loafers. Both on and off of work, Mary retains her thin gold wristwatch and heart pendant necklace. Mary has become a successful therapist and book author, but is still haunted by her past. After observing the demolition of her childhood home in favor of a housing complex, Mary retrieves her handprint she had left in the concrete outside as a child and leaves. Mary Kline is characterized as an optimistic therapist concerned with the mental wellbeing of her patients. She seemingly spent most of her childhood locked indoors by her extremely paranoid mother, Nora, and as a result, Mary grew up wanting to help people overcome their mental barriers in order to prevent them ending up like her mother. This is demonstrated when she took the time to search for Clark after losing contact with him, traveling to his store, Cap'n Clark's Ottoman Empire, and willing to brave the unknown in order to save his mind. Async The Async Research Institute (also known as the Async Foundation or simply Async) is a research organization responsible for opening the Threshold (using the Low-Proximity Magnetic Distortion System) into the Backrooms. It is located at the Async Research Facility in San Jose, California. They originally created MRI Machines for use in hospitals, however in April of 1988 Async started an experiment on opening a doorway into the Backrooms based on a prototype by Oak Ridge National Laboratory six years prior. The experiments were directed by vice director Ivan Beck and were described as a solution for all future storage and housing needs. The experiments continued as they got funding from the government.
